I am an experienced elementary educator with a strong passion for helping young learners build confidence and a love for learning. I have spent over 10 years in education, including teaching kindergarten, where I specialize in early literacy, phonics, and foundational math skills. I am currently pursuing my Master of Arts in Teaching (MAT) in Elementary Education through Asbury University, and I am deeply committed to using research-based, developmentally appropriate practices to support student growth.
My teaching approach is engaging, supportive, and tailored to each child’s individual needs. I use explicit, systematic phonics instruction combined with hands-on and multisensory strategies to help students develop strong reading skills. I also incorporate movement, games, and interactive activities to keep students motivated and involved in the learning process. Whether I am working on letter sounds, blending, sight words, or early math concepts, I strive to make learning both effective and enjoyable.
I have experience working with a wide range of learners in both whole group and one-on-one settings, and I understand that every child learns differently. I am passionate about building strong relationships with my students and creating a safe, encouraging environment where they feel successful.
